The Overall Health Score in 37032, Cedar Hill, Tennessee is 56 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

93.82 percent of the population in 37032 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 40.94 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 13.33 percent of the residents in 37032 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.67 members with about 2.49 cars available per household.

An estimate of 89.76 percent of the residents in 37032 has some form of health insurance. 24.62 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 72.82 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 37032 would have to travel an average of 14.58 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Tennova Healthcare-Clarksville . In a 20-mile radius, there are 722 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 37032, Cedar Hill, Tennessee.

As of , an estimate of 5,236 residents live in 37032 with a median age of 36.4 years. 25.55 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 10.73 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 41.32 percent of the residents in 37032 is currently married, and 19.10 percent of the population has never been married.

The monthly median household income in 37032 is $7,388.42.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 37032 is approximately $1,104. The median household spends about 14.94 percent of their income on housing.
